137, Brambles, (4 Newman’s Cottages) Milton Road

History of 137 Milton Road

1911

James William Lawford, 37, cycle and motor mechanic, b Surrey

Louisa, 37, b London

John William, 15, tobacconist errand boy, b London

Alfred Herbert, 13, b Surrey

Edith Margery, 7, b Chesterton

Robert Ayers, boarder, 69, housepainter retired, b Liverpool

Jack Carden, boarder, 32, cycle mechanic cycle and motor works, b Sussex


1913

James W Lawford
